A hidden paradise! 4-hour drive from Manila to Camaya then another 45-mins.travel through the rough road. Super fun adventure! (Laki ng bukol ko, sobrang lalim ng mga lubak pero enjoy! ) Also accessible via 30-min. boat ride (P3,500 per boat of 8-10 passenger). When you arrive at the Island, the locals will welcome you with warm smile. They are very kind and helpful. Nippa huts, cottages and tents are available for rent. There are convenience sari-sari store where you can buy everything you need from food, medicine, toiletries and basic cooking needs. Shower & comfort rooms were supplied with overflowing water from the spring, so no need to worry about shortage. You can borrow barbeque grill for free. You can buy freshly picked coconut for P30.00 to P40.00 each. Laki Beach Resort has no Power Supply so they only provide light through diesel-power generator until 12mn.
